The Neonatal Ethics Lab centers is developing multiple concentration "nodes" the highlight the expertise and interests of our researchers.
Our research focuses currently include:
Prenatal consultation and shared decision-making for periviability and congenital anomalies
Perinatal risk stratification and care coordination
Tracheostomy shared decision-making
Research ethics and technical innovations in the newborn intensive care unit
Ultra-long hospitalizations for children
End-of-life decision-making for children on extracorporeal life-support
